Grant CommentsOutput is at the antenna terminal of the device. This transmitter operates with vehicle-mount antennas that must be installed to provide a separation distance of 20 cm or more from persons for satisfying MPE categorical exclusion requirements of 2.1091. The antenna gain and cable loss must not exceed 1.5 W ERP. Users and installers must be informed of the operating requirements for satisfying RF exposure requirements.
